**Laboratory Incubator Market Product Type Insights  **

The Laboratory Incubator Market revenue for 2023 is valued at 3.39 billion USD, reflecting the ongoing demand for various types of incubators in laboratory settings. The market is defined by a range of Product Types, including CO2 Incubators, Static Incubators, Shaking Incubators, Incubator Shakers, and Refrigerated Incubators. CO2 Incubators are essential for cell culture applications, providing stable CO2 levels for optimal growth, which underscores their continued significance in the market.

Static Incubators prove vital in microbiological research while Shaking Incubators enable enhanced mixing and aeration for cultures requiring agitation.Incubator Shakers further expand laboratory capabilities, often utilized in biochemical processes, whereas Refrigerated Incubators play a critical role in preserving temperature-sensitive samples. **Laboratory Incubator Market Regional Insights  **

The Laboratory Incubator Market is experiencing steady growth across various regions, with a projected revenue of 3.39 USD Billion in 2023. North America leads this segment, holding a majority share with a valuation of 1.2 USD Billion, showing significant market dominance. Following closely, the APAC region holds a valuation of 1.03 USD Billion, indicating its rising importance due to increased investments in research and development. Europe stands at 0.9 USD Billion, supported by robust scientific research and healthcare sectors.

South America and MEA are smaller markets, with valuations of 0.15 USD Billion and 0.11 USD Billion, respectively, in 2023, reflecting emerging opportunities in these regions.As the market evolves, trends such as technological advancements in incubator designs and growing biopharmaceutical sectors are driving growth. **Laboratory Incubator Market Industry Developments**

Recent developments in the Laboratory Incubator Market have shown dynamic growth and innovation, particularly among key players such as Thermo Fisher Scientific, Eppendorf, and Memmert. These companies are continuously enhancing their product lines by integrating advanced technologies to meet the evolving needs of laboratories. Current affairs highlight a notable trend toward sustainability and energy efficiency, drawing increased attention from both consumers and manufacturers alike. Companies like Nuaire and Becker have been focusing on developing incubators that minimize environmental impact.

In the realm of mergers and acquisitions, there has been significant movement, particularly with Benchmark Scientific acquiring Labnet International, which has broadened its product portfolio and market reach.

Furthermore, Thermo Fisher Scientific is reported to be in discussions to acquire Hettich, aiming to enhance its capabilities in providing comprehensive laboratory solutions.
